As the United States Postal Service takes center stage in American politics, Gruntled Postal Workers is a hilarious ode to the role of the Service in American popular culture:
Cliff Clavin, know-it-all barfly from the sitcom "Cheers", and Newman from "Seinfeld"––both fictional postal workers––are pictured dancing together as a brilliant parody of Matisse on an exclusive die-cut stamp.

ABOUT Ron English:
Ron English is widely considered a seminal figure in the advancement of street art away from traditional wild-style lettering into clever statement and masterful trompe l’oeil based art. He has created illegal murals and billboards that blend stunning visuals with biting political, consumerist and surrealist statements, hijacking public space worldwide for the sake of art since the 1980s.
